We are seeking a compassionate and dedicated Primary Teacher to join a welcoming and well-resourced SEN school in Twickenham. This is a rewarding opportunity to support pupils within a SEN primary setting, helping them develop academically, socially, and emotionally.
The successful candidate will work with pupils across Key Stage 1 and/or Key Stage 2, including those with Special Educational Needs and Disabilities (SEND) such as Autism (ASD), ADHD, SEMH, and moderate learning difficulties.
Key Responsibilities
Plan and deliver engaging and differentiated lessons for pupils in KS1 or KS2
Support pupils with additional learning needs through personalised teaching approaches
Work closely with Teaching Assistants, SENCOs, and support staff
Implement strategies outlined in Education, Health and Care Plans (EHCPs)
Foster a safe, inclusive, and nurturing classroom environment
Monitor pupil progress and adapt teaching to support development
